    On Holtby, I probably agree with you. Backstrom, though? Probably an underpay when it comes to term. He's very nearly a career point-per-game player and will have played on possibly the best contract in hockey for a decade. $9.25mil is a hometown discount based on where the salary cap will be. If the Caps don't give him the term, you better believe someone will empty a vault out for him. Of everyone that's played at least 550 games since he signed his current contract (2010-11; 160 players overall), he's 2nd in assists, 8th in points, 7th in points per game, and 13th in faceoffs taken.
